2022-23
- Appeared in seven games averaging 3.7 points in 11.3 minutes per game.
- Scored 16 points in 16 minutes going 3-for-3 from behind the arc in the season-opener against Warner on Nov. 7.
- Played a season-high 22 minutes with eight points and three rebounds against Wisconsin.
- Went 8-for-20 (40.0%) on the season with five three pointers (55.6%) in her seven games played.
Prior to UNF
- Transferred in from Queens University (Charlotte)
- Posted 11.4 points per game and brought down 2.6 rebounds per contest in 489 minutes and 17 games started in her second year at Queens
- Registered 13.8 points per game in five contests during her freshman season
- Broke the 1,000-point career milestone at Trinity Episcopal School during high school
- All-state selection in Virginia
- Played for Team Loaded on the AAU circuit
- Won a state title in high school
Personal
- Majoring in psychology
- Daughter of Jenan and Rabih Hamze
- Has one sibling, Julian
- Honor roll student in high school
